« Reply #14 on: Tuesday 09 May 23 11:16 BST (UK) »
Many thanks for looking amondg.

Yes, I’ve ordered quite a few of those Birth Certificates over the years, but none of them seem to fit…

I’ve never been able to find my Grandfather William James Wilson anywhere before he married my Grandmother Margaret Rees in Swansea in June 1893. On that Certificate he gives his age as 32 years, Occuption: House Painter. Father’s name as William Wilson (Deceased) Occupation: Mason.

I’ve never been able to find a William Wilson, Mason, with a son William James Wilson.

I have my Grandparents on the 1901, 1911 and 1921 Censuses for Swansea. And I have his Death Certificate, - he died on the 29th December 1937.

I’m either missing something obvious, or he was using a different name before he married my Grandmother…

Romilly 😱😰
